Edit in JSFiddle


              
<div class="container">
    <div class="msgUser">User1</div>
    <div class="content">Hey, what is going on over there? I don't understand what you are trying to say</div>
    <div class="msgTime">7:50 pm</div>
</div>
<div class="container">
    <div class="msgUser">User2</div>
    <div class="content">Huh?  Are you talking to me?   I need to write some more lines to see how this stacks and wraps</div>
    <div class="msgTime">7:48 pm</div>
</div>
.container {
    border:solid 1px #DEDEDE; 
    background:#EFEFEF;
    color:#222222;
    padding-top: 1px;
    padding-bottom: 5px;
    padding-left: 5px;
    padding-right: 5px;
    font-family: arial,sans-serif;
    overflow:auto;
}

.content{
    background:#EFEFEF;
    color:#222222;
    padding-top: 1px;
    padding-bottom: 10px;
    padding-left: 5px;
    padding-right: 5px;
    font-family: arial,sans-serif;
}

.content {
    border:solid 1px #DEDEDE;
    padding-top: 25px;
    padding-bottom: 0px;
    padding-left: 0px;
    padding-right: 0px;
}

.msgTime {
    font-size:10px;
    float: right;
}

.msgUser {
    position:fixed;
    font-size:10px;
    float: left;
}